    Abstract: The invention relates to a process for pulping waste paper containing impurities, used in the production of paper and board, with a feed device, a dewiring unit, and a pulping section. In order to improve pulping and thus generate less non-screenable impurities, which would make it possible to use larger proportions of waste paper with water-soluble inks, a liquid penetration stage is included in the process before pulping.
